Wood is a cdp located in Pulaski County, in the state of Missouri (MO), United States. Nestled in the West North Central division of the Midwest region, it covers an area of 97.2 square miles (252.0 km²) and sits at an elevation of N/A. With a population of approximately 13,666 residents, Wood offers a vibrant community life.

The town's population is composed of about 61.28% males and 38.72% females, and it has a population density of 140.60 people per square mile (54.28/km²). Wood lies at a latitude of 37.74 and a longitude of -92.12, operating in the UTC-6.

Locals reflect a blend of American ancestry, with roots primarily in United States (7.6%), followed by English (4.6%), German (16.5%), and Scotch-Irish (0%) heritage. The town is identified by the ZIP code 65473.
